Fedhealth Blue Door Plus optionFedhealth Blue Door Plus offers a value for money option for lower income, previously uncovered employees who have never previously enjoyed any medical scheme cover due to it being unaffordable. This option is not suitable for people already on a medical aid or those with higher benefit requirements.

This manual lists the services and benefits that are covered for the Blue Door Plus option for 2015.

Major Medical Benefit Please note the following important points:• Costsforhospitalisationarecoveredunlimitedfromthisbenefit-fromthefirstdayofhospitalisationinpublicornetworkprivate

hospitals• Voluntaryuseofnon-networkorpublichospitalswillresultinthememberhavingtomakeaco-paymentof40%ontheirhospitalbill• OrgantransplantsandrenaldialysisarecoveredasPrescribedMinimumBenefitsatstatefacilitiesonly• OncologyiscoveredunlimitedasaPrescribedMinimumBenefitattheIndependentClinicalOncologyNetwork(ICON),theScheme’s

DesignatedServiceProvider• HospitaladmissionsrequireareferralfromanominatedGPandmustbepre-authorisedbytheHealthcareProfessionalManagedCare

Lineon0861100220• PsychiatricadmissionsarelimitedtoR7600perfamilyperyearandwillrequireareferralfromanominatedGPandissubjecttopre-

authorisation• MaternityhasalimitofR31200perpregnancy,withalimitofR46200perfamilyperyear.ElectiveCaesariansectionsaresubjecttoa

40%co-payment.

Acute medicine• Fordispensingdoctorsacutemedicineformspartofthefixedfeeforconsultationsandnoacutemedicinewillbepaidadditionalto

thisfee• Eventhoughafixedfeeispaid,themedicinebillingcodesmustberecordedontheaccount.Thisensuresproperinformationon

dispensingpatternsandisrequiredforqualitymanagementpurposes• Anacutemedicinesformularyisavailabletonon-dispensingdoctors.Thisformularyrepresentsleastcostlyandyeteffective

genericproductsandcanbeusedasaprescribingguide•Itisimportantfordoctorstoprescribemedicinesontheacuteformularysothatmembersdonothaveanyoutofpocketexpenses. Acutemedicinesthatarenotontheacuteformularywillnotbecovered.

Chronic medication•MedschemeappliesaDiseaseAuthorisationmodelwhichmeansthatonceapatientisapprovedforachronicconditiontheywill

haveaccesstoaselectionofpre-approvedmedicinesforthecondition,referredtoasabasket.ThemedicineinthebasketisstillsubjecttoMPLandoutofformularyco-paymentsandcanbeviewedonwww.medscheme.co.zabyloggingintotheproviderzone.Apatientcanupdateorchangetheirmedicinedirectlywiththepharmacywiththeirnewprescription.Notallconditionsaremanagedthisway;apatientwillneedtocontacttheschemeif:~themedicineisnotinthebasket;or~theyarediagnosedwithanewchroniccondition;or~theyneedaquantityordosageofamedicinethatismorethanthequantitylistedinthebasket.

From 01 January 2015, the Fedhealth Blue Door Plus Option will be applying the Basic Chronic Formulary (also known as the Low Option Chronic Formulary). The following must be kept in mind when prescribing chronic medication to Blue Door Plus members:

• ChronicmedicationmustbeprescribedbyaBlueDoorPluscontractedGP• ChronicmedicationisprovidedthroughaDesignatedServiceProvider,Medi-Ritepharmacies• Aco-paymentof40%willapplytomedicinesoutsideofformularyorprescribedbyanon-designatedserviceprovider• 26PMB(CDL)conditionsonly• MedschemeBasicFormularyapplies(alsoknownastheLowOptionChronicFormulary)• Memberstoregisterforchronicmedication• MedicinePriceList(MPL)ruleapplieswhichensuresthatthemosteffectiveandyetcosteffectivegenericswillbesuppliedtoBlue

DoorPlusmembers.

Telephonic chronic medicine application• CallourChronicMedicineManagementdepartmentbetween08h30and17h00on0861100220andselectoptionnumber3• Yourcallwillberoutedthroughtoaclinicalconsultant.Makesureyouhaveallrelevantdetailsofyourpatientathand• Onapprovalthemedicationwillbepaidfromthechronicmedicinebenefit• Normal0199paymentwillapplyforfirsttimetelephonicregistrations.

Online chronic medicine application• LogintotheMedschemewebsite(www.medscheme.co.za)andclickonChronicApplication• Loginwithyourusernameandpassword.Pleaseregisterifyouareafirsttimeuser• Makesurethatyouhavealltherelevantpatientdetailsathandtocompletetheonlineapplication• Remembertheonlineapplicationcanbeusedformembersapplyingforchronicmedicineforthefirsttimeorforupdatingcurrent authorisations•Normal0199paymentwillapplyforfirsttimeonlinechronicapplications.

Aid for Aids (AfA)• SubjecttoregistrationandmanagementbyAfA• MedicineprovidedbyMedi-Ritepharmacies• PathologytestsarepartofmanagementbyAfA• Benefitincludestreatmentformother-to-childtransmission,rape,andpost-exposure-prophylaxis.
